All-Terrain Buggy Review All-terrain pushchairs are a great option if you prefer to explore different terrains and don't mind about getting muddy. Many come with large wheels and suspensions, making them ideal for muddy terrains than standard pushchairs. Look for a buggy with good suspension and air filled tyres. Also, check if the front wheel can lock to help with stability when jogging. During the testing, Liz took the Peach 6 out over a variety of terrains including narrow pavements, wet fields, gravel, and sports ground. The suspension helped her to enjoy the ride on rough and difficult terrain. The front wheels can be rotated for easy cornering and the chassis comes with an easy-to-use one-click locking system that allows you to increase the firmness of the ride on more challenging terrain. The Peach is easily maneuverable through doorways and into shops due to its small footprint and tight turn circle. It's also great for public transport and will fit into a standard wheelchair-friendly space. The handlebar is adjustable to four different positions, and has a lovely leatherette cover that feels comfortable in your hands. Folding is easy by one hand, and is secured with an auto-lock. It's small and can be folded completely on its own. It has a pocket in the back of the seat, which is ideal for storing important things like phones and keys. The Peach 7 can be used from birth up to 25kg. ( pushchairsandprams.uk with no elevators). It is able to be converted to a double pushchair using the iCandy Peach 2+ Twin Kit, sold separately. The seat unit is placed in both parent and world-facing mode. The carrycot has been updated to be safe for overnight sleeping. It's easy to take off the chassis by unclicking each side one at a time. Out and About Swift™ A sturdy all-terrain pushchair is essential if you are a fan of forest walks or adventurous off-road adventures. They are also ideal when you want to be able to jog with your baby and will cope with kerbs and rough terrain much more easily than standard pushchairs. These pushchairs are slightly stronger than lighter compact pushchairs and might have different tyres for dealing with rougher terrain. Some models come with a lockable front wheel, and a few particularly those designed for running – have a brake control on the handlebar, too. The iCandy Swift has an excellent reputation in the all-terrain buggy market and MFM reviewer Kath discovered that it “navigates well over grass, bumpy pavements cobbles, dirt tracks, and cobbles and can handle the slope of kerbs with ease”. The suspension and large 16” air-filled rear tires ensure the children with a smooth ride. The capability to lock the wheels onto the front (on both the three-wheel and four-wheel versions) is also a very useful feature when you have to traverse difficult terrain or climb a steep step. You should also look out for features such as a adjustable height of the swivel chair as well as the suspension that can be adjusted to accommodate a car seat or carrycot. Also, make sure that the tyres can be changed to puncture-proof ones. This will make it easier to tackle rough terrain and reduce the possibility of losing an extra in the middle of nowhere!
